a student wants to construct the perpendicular bisector of $overline{ab}$ using a straightedge and a compass. the student first draws an arc using point $a$ as the center. which
the radius is equal to half the length of $overline{ab}$.
the radius is less than half the length of $overline{ab}$.
the radius is greater than half the length of $overline{ab}$.
the radius is equal to one - third of the length of $overline{ab}$.

Explanation:

Brief Explanations

在使用直尺和圆规作线段$AB$的垂直平分线时,以点$A$为圆心画弧,半径需大于线段$AB$长度的一半,这样后续以点$B$为圆心画弧才能与之前的弧相交,从而确定垂直平分线上的点。

Answer:

The radius is greater than half the length of $\overline{AB}$.
